162 lines
No EOL
7.2 KiB
HTML
162 lines
No EOL
7.2 KiB
HTML
<html>
|
|
<head>
|
|
<title>Sahli Editor</title>
|
|
<!-- changed to local copies to avoid party network "dropouts" preventing the code from running
|
|
as it can't be pulled from afar if the network is down. Use remote if you would like, just uncomment
|
|
<script src="//code.jquery.com/jquery-2.1.0.min.js" type="text/javascript" charset="utf-8"></script>
|
|
<script src="//code.jquery.com/ui/1.10.4/jquery-ui.min.js" type="text/javascript" charset="utf-8" ></script>
|
|
-->
|
|
<script src="jquery-2.1.0.min.js" type="text/javascript" async defer></script>
|
|
<script src="jquery-ui.min.js" type="text/javascript" async defer></script>
|
|
<script src="/editor/sahliedit.js" type="text/javascript" charset="utf-8" async defer></script>
|
|
<link rel="stylesheet" href="/editor/sahliedit.css">
|
|
<link rel="stylesheet" href="//code.jquery.com/ui/1.10.4/themes/dot-luv/jquery-ui.css">
|
|
</head>
|
|
<body>
|
|
<h1>Sahli Editor</h1>
|
|
<div id='editbox'>
|
|
<div id='buttonbox'>
|
|
<button id='newsahli'>New</button>
|
|
<button id='loadsahli'>Load</button>
|
|
</div>
|
|
</div>
|
|
|
|
<div class='hidden' id='list'>
|
|
<ol id='sortlist'>
|
|
</ol>
|
|
<p id='listsave'>Save</p>
|
|
</div>
|
|
|
|
<div class='hidden' id='formica'>
|
|
<form accept-charset="utf-8">
|
|
<ul>
|
|
<div class='groupbox' id='basics'>
|
|
<p>Basics:</p>
|
|
<div class='drop'>
|
|
<li>
|
|
<input type="text" id="entryindex" value="" class='hidden'>
|
|
<label for="file">File name:</label>
|
|
<input id='entryfile' type="text" name="file" value="" placeholder="">
|
|
<input id='entryfilepick' type="file" class='hidden' name="pickfile" value="" placeholder="">
|
|
</li>
|
|
<li>
|
|
<label for="file">Title:</label>
|
|
<input id='entryname' type="text" name="name" value="" placeholder="">
|
|
</li>
|
|
<li>
|
|
<label for="author">Author's name:</label>
|
|
<input id='entryauthor' type="text" name="author" value="" placeholder="">
|
|
</li>
|
|
</div>
|
|
</div>
|
|
<div class='groupbox' id='displaydata'>
|
|
<p>Display:</p>
|
|
<div class='drop' id='fl'>
|
|
<li>
|
|
<label for="file">Ascii or Ansi?</label>
|
|
<button id='entryamiga' name="amiga" id='amiga' type='button' value='1'>Ascii</button>
|
|
</li>
|
|
<li>
|
|
<label for='filetype'>File Type:</label>
|
|
<select>
|
|
<option value="plain">plain</option>
|
|
<option value="ansi">ansi</option>
|
|
<option value="xbin">xbin</option>
|
|
<option value="ice">ice</option>
|
|
<option value="adf">adf</option>
|
|
<option value="avatar">avatar</option>
|
|
<option value="bin">bin</option>
|
|
<option value="idf">idf</option>
|
|
<option value="pcboard">pcboard</option>
|
|
<option value="tundra">tundra</option>
|
|
</select>
|
|
</li>
|
|
<li>
|
|
<label for="width">Width of file:</label>
|
|
<input id='entrywidth' type="number" name="width" value="80" placeholder="">
|
|
</li>
|
|
<li>
|
|
<label for="font">Font:</label>
|
|
<select id='entryfont' name="font">
|
|
<option value="Propaz">Propaz</option>
|
|
<!-- <option value="Topaz13">Topaz13</option> -->
|
|
<!-- <option value="mOsOli">mOsOli</option> -->
|
|
<!-- <option value="MicroKnight">Microknight</option> -->
|
|
<option value="ansifont">Ansifont</option>
|
|
</select>
|
|
</li>
|
|
<div class='45box'>
|
|
<li>
|
|
<label for="color">Text Color:</label>
|
|
<select name="color" id='entrycolor' class='colorbox'>
|
|
<option value="#E0E0E0">Light Grey</option>
|
|
<option value="#A0A0E0">Light Blue</option>
|
|
<option value="#9AFe2e">Light Green</option>
|
|
<option value="#FF0000">Red</option>
|
|
<option value="#FF8000">Orange</option>
|
|
<option value="#FFFF00">Yellow</option>
|
|
<option value="#00f000">Green</option>
|
|
<option value="#2efeF7">Cyan</option>
|
|
<option value="#2efeF7">Blue</option>
|
|
<option value="#0b0b3b">Navy</option>
|
|
<option value="#FF00FF">Magenta</option>
|
|
<option value="#8000FF">Purple</option>
|
|
<option value="#0a2a0a">Dark Green</option>
|
|
<option value="#3b3b3b">Dark Grey</option>
|
|
<option value="#FFFFFF">White</option>
|
|
<option value="#000000">Black</option>
|
|
</select>
|
|
</li>
|
|
<li>
|
|
<label for="bg">Background color:</label>
|
|
<select name="bg" id='entrybg' class='colorbox'>
|
|
<option value="#E0E0E0">Light Grey</option>
|
|
<option value="#A0A0E0">Light Blue</option>
|
|
<option value="#9AFe2e">Light Green</option>
|
|
<option value="#FF0000">Red</option>
|
|
<option value="#FF8000">Orange</option>
|
|
<option value="#FFFF00">Yellow</option>
|
|
<option value="#00f000">Green</option>
|
|
<option value="#2efeF7">Cyan</option>
|
|
<option value="#2efeF7">Blue</option>
|
|
<option value="#0b0b3b">Navy</option>
|
|
<option value="#FF00FF">Magenta</option>
|
|
<option value="#8000FF">Purple</option>
|
|
<option value="#0a2a0a">Dark Green</option>
|
|
<option value="#3b3b3b">Dark Grey</option>
|
|
<option value="#FFFFFF">White</option>
|
|
<option value="#000000">Black</option>
|
|
</select>
|
|
</li>
|
|
</div>
|
|
<div class='45box'>
|
|
<pre>
|
|
________________________, ._____,
|
|
| ___|___ | | | | |_____|
|
|
|_____ | _ | | |__| |
|
|
|_____|_____|___|__|______|___|
|
|
</pre>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
<div class='groupbox' id='optionals'>
|
|
<p>Optional text:</p>
|
|
<div class='drop'>
|
|
<li>
|
|
<label for="line1">Optional Info line 1:</label>
|
|
<input id='entryline1' type="text" name="line1" value="" placeholder="">
|
|
</li>
|
|
<li>
|
|
<label for="line2">Optional Info line 2:</label>
|
|
<input id='entryline2' type="text" name="line2" value="" placeholder="">
|
|
</li>
|
|
<li>
|
|
<label for="text">Optional Text (notes, comments, etc):</label>
|
|
<textarea id='entrytext' name='text'></textarea>
|
|
</li>
|
|
</div>
|
|
</ul>
|
|
</form>
|
|
</div>
|
|
</body>
|
|
</html> |